Principle of Anonymous Coins

Anonymous coins typically ensure privacy through the following techniques:
  • Ring Signature: Ring signature technology allows a sender to generate a signature from multiple possible candidates, making it impossible to identify the exact sender.
  • Zero-Knowledge Proof: Zero-knowledge proof allows one party to prove the truth of a statement without disclosing any specific information. For example, a user has sufficient funds to complete a transaction, but does not disclose the account balance or other details.
  • Mix Network: Through the encrypted transmission of multiple nodes and data mixing, the transaction path becomes more complex, increasing the difficulty of tracking.
  • Fungibility of Anonymous Coins: Anonymous coins are typically fungible, meaning each anonymous coin is identical to others and cannot be traced back to the original transaction.
